A small (seats 20), family-owned restaurant tucked into a strip near an antiques cooperative, the Gobble Stop was clearly a neighborhood favorite. Lots of pickup orders from regulars who (without exception) recommended the turkey tips, a couple other customers traveling through who asked for recommendations...of their own. One of the owners, Demond, and his family dealt cheerfully with a steady flow of business. Customers waiting interacted both with us and one another, and the food was delicious. 1 lb. of turkey tips, 2 4-oz. sides, and drinks cost under $25, and was plenty for my husband and me. We had beans (spicy!) and fresh collard greens as our sides. The turkey tips (the dark meat on the bird’s back) were tender and perfectly seasoned, but we enjoyed them with the mustard BBQ sauce, too. The collard greens were indeed fresh, a nice bright green and not overly salted. This could have been a faceless space, but for the decor. That it is not is due to a collection of original paintings by a church member, known for doing art projects in the St. Louis Museum, each with a 3-D component. No longer able to create due to illness, Demond’s mother told us, she is still clearly influential in their lives. I highly recommend a stop at the Gobble StopMore
